A kind of boring method of gear dowel hole
Technical field
The present invention relates to Gear Production processing technique field, particularly a kind of boring method of gear dowel hole.
Background technology
In production, locating and machining pin hole is often needed on gear, positioning when being installed for gear;But in workshop, When being processed to larger gear, since gear is very heavy, the instruments such as the overhead traveling crane in workshop need to be often used by gear hoisting to lathe On, since lathe upper end is often suspended to overhead traveling crane hawser, so so setting gear very inconvenient, and need to process on gear Dowel hole quantity it is more, often process a dowel hole and be required to overhead traveling crane and coordinate rotate gear, so not only positioning accuracy Difference, and it is also especially low into production efficiency.
The content of the invention
The technical problems to be solved by the invention are to provide a kind of boring method of gear dowel hole, can be in drilling machine Bed is outer to pre-set gear, and gear is moved in parallel along certain track line to drilling rod, so as to improve determining for gear Position precision;And after the completion of being positioned to gear need not carrier wheel again, this not only improve the machining accuracy of dowel hole and And production efficiency can be improved, reduce production cost.
In order to realize the purpose for solving above-mentioned technical problem, present invention employs following technical solution:
A kind of boring method of gear dowel hole, comprises the following steps:
Step 1:One horizontal slide rail is set outside drilling hole machine tool, and horizontal slide rail extends to the underface of drilling hole machine tool;
Step 2:One positioning trolley is set on horizontal slide rail, which includes frame body and four traveling wheels;Frame body Outer rim is equipped with concave part;Traveling wheel is arranged on below frame body or outside, is used to support frame body;Traveling wheel is arranged on horizontal slide rail It can move above and on horizontal slide rail;Positioning trolley can be moved to the lower section of drilling hole machine tool along horizontal slide rail;
Step 3:One support device is set on positioning trolley, the support device include price fixing, turntable, needle bearing and Central rotating shaft;Price fixing and center of turntable are equipped with needle bearing;Central rotating shaft, which connects two needle bearings, can simultaneously make turntable and determine Disk relatively rotates;Price fixing is horizontally fixed on frame body;The concave part relative position of price fixing and frame body is equipped with strip through-hole;On turntable Equipped with multiple hollow bulbs, hollow bulb position is corresponding with the dowel hole position on gear;The support device is used to support to be added Work gear, and work gear to be added can be driven in drilling hole machine tool rotated down;
Step 4:On gear hoisting to be processed to support device and gear will be made concentric with turntable;
Step 5:The position of locating and machining pin hole is needed to make marks on work gear to be added;
Step 6:One anti-rotation device is set in support device, the anti-rotation device include positioning pin, supporting rod, sleeve, turn Moving part, threaded rod and handle;Supporting rod is fixed on price fixing outer rim;Sleeve is equipped with the internal thread to match with threaded rod, it is horizontal It is fixed on supporting rod;Sleeve portion is higher than disk upper surface;Positioning pin is wedged plate, it passes through rotating member connection screw thread bar One end, the other end of threaded rod are equipped with handle;Threaded rod is arranged in sleeve;
Step 7:Rotating the handle of anti-rotation device makes positioning pin be inserted between two teeth of work gear to be added;
Step 8:Below running fix trolley to drilling hole machine tool, the mark position on work gear to be added is set to be located at drilling rod just Lower section;
Step 9:Start the drilling that drilling hole machine tool completes first dowel hole;
Step 10:After the processing for completing first dowel hole, rotating the handle of anti-rotation device, to leave positioning pin to be added Work gear;
Step 11:The turntable of rotation support device, makes next mark position of work gear to be added be located at immediately below drilling rod;
Step 12:Rotating the handle of anti-rotation device makes positioning pin again insertable between two teeth of work gear to be added;
Step 13:Start the drilling that drilling hole machine tool completes second dowel hole;
Step 14:Repeat step ten is to step 13, until work gear subscript to be added note position drills and finishes;
Step 15:Running fix trolley is left below drilling hole machine tool;
Step 10 six:The gear of machined complete dowel hole is unloaded from support device;
Step 10 seven:Storage box is taken out, pours out the waste residue produced in boring procedure.
Specifically:The turntable outer rim is equipped with one or more handle groove.This is to coordinate handle convenient Turntable is rotated, and detachable handle can avoid the obstruction of supporting rod, ensure that turntable can rotate a circle with respect to price fixing.
Specifically:Storage box is equipped with below the concave part of the frame body.This is to collect to Gear Processing positioning pin Kong Shi, falls into turntable hollow bulb and obtains waste residue, these waste residues are moved when turntable is rotated with turntable, when hollow bulb passes through the bar of price fixing During shape through hole, crash into storage box.
